| | |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te |
Autor
|
Thema: Koordinaten von Polylinie (1695 mal gelesen)
|
Silvan01 Mitglied
Beiträge: 128 Registriert: 28.04.2009 AutoCAD Civil 2009 AutoCAD Civil 2010 Visual Studio 2008
|
erstellt am: 06. Aug. 2009 15:37 <-- editieren / zitieren --> Unities abgeben:
Hallo Zusammen, ich ändere momentan ein Programm von VBA zu Vb.NET In VBA hab ich folgendermaßen meine Koordinaten einer Polylinie bekommen: ---------------------------------------------------------------------- Public Coord As Variant Dim Polyline As AcadPolyline Coord = Polyline.Coordinates ---------------------------------------------------------------------- Und dann konnte ich mit meinen Koordinaten arbeiten. Aber in VB.Net finde ich keinen Befehl der mir die Punkte gibt. Ich hab die Extends und Bounds gefunden mehr aber auch nicht. Wie kann ich die Koordinaten der Polyline abfragen? Grüße Silvan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Ex-Mitglied
|
erstellt am: 06. Aug. 2009 21:40 <-- editieren / zitieren -->
Hi, Code: Dim tPnts As Geometry.Point3dCollection = New Geometry.Point3dCollection Call CType(Poly,DatabaseServices.Curve).GetStretchPoints(tPnts)
- alfred - ------------------ www.hollaus.at |
Silvan01 Mitglied
Beiträge: 128 Registriert: 28.04.2009 AutoCAD Civil 2009 AutoCAD Civil 2010 Visual Studio 2008
|
erstellt am: 07. Aug. 2009 08:58 <-- editieren / zitieren --> Unities abgeben:
|
Ex-Mitglied
|
erstellt am: 07. Aug. 2009 09:10 <-- editieren / zitieren -->
Hi Silvan, der Cast zu DatabaseServices.Curve funktioniert bei allem, was eine linienzugartige Graphikausprägung hat, also Linie, Bögen, Kreise, LWPolylinien, 2D-Polylinien, 3D-Polylinien, Ellipsen, elliptische Bögen, ...(weitere). - alfred - ------------------ www.hollaus.at |
| Anzeige.:
Anzeige: (Infos zum Werbeplatz >>)
|